Backcountry Treasures

Two preserved wooden haylofts of the once uncountable architectural works distributed along the whole Velka Fatra Mts. (let alone the whole Carpathians). Now as the way of living has changed dramatically, if lucky, such buildings serve mostly as a place for a tourist bivac. These particular haylofts above the village Hubová and under the mountain Kútnikov kopec were saved by volunteers in 1987, and repeatedly repaired 30 years later. In such a scenery, you feel the sense of remoteness not only in place but also in time.
